    Re: Service Unavailable error message while browsing IIS 6.0 Web page on Windows Server 2003

    This issue may occur if the server that is running Microsoft Internet Information Services (IIS) 6.0 is also a domain controller. You need to verify that the application pool is configured for the virtual server. The problem occurs because the Application pool is using the NT Authority\Network Service account, and the NT Authority\Network Service account may not have permissions to access the required folders. The default application pool is MSSharePointPortalAppPool.

    Re: Service Unavailable error message while browsing IIS 6.0 Web page on Windows Server 2003

    To resolve this problem, manually set permissions on the folders for the IIS_WPG group, and then set permissions on the folders for the NT Authority\Network Service account. For security purposes, the description that is sent back to the client (Service Unavailable) does not fully describe the error. HTTP.sys keeps its own error log. Just check out the following link.
